Its almost like in Germany the autobahns I lived in Germany for three years, yeah right drive as fast as you want to, no speed limit. Well you don't know how wrong you are. There are speed limits matter of fact around cities and such they are enforced with extreme prejudice. Now once out of the city limits on the Autobahns they stay the same speed limit but not enforced (enforced has a red circle around the speed limit not enforced has a grey circle around it). However if you are in an accident considering how much more out of the recommended speed limit you are puts you more to blame or are responsible for.
Really doesn't matter the speed limit more about the driving conditions thats why we have yellow recommended signs for curves and such to better help the driver be cautious of an unexpected curve or obstruction in the roadway.
